We are looking for an enthusiastic, highly motivated Business Support Officer to enhance our already established friendly and supportive team who will contribute to a key area of work of the Resources Directorate.


This is a full-time, permanent post working 37 hours per week and supports the Information Governance Team within Legal, Governance & Registrars based at County Hall, Preston and providing administrational support to the Information Governance Team.


What we are looking for:


Passion - You'll be passionate about delivering a great service and enjoy dealing with people, asking for support when you need it and building on the skills that you've developed elsewhere.


Knowledge and Experience - Ideally you will have experience of working within a busy and varied administration setting and have knowledge of using Microsoft packages and databases and importing/exporting electronic files.


Great Communication - You'll be engaging and providing support and liaising with third party organisations, members of the public and the rest of the team on a daily basis, so being able to communicate information clearly and confidently and listen to individual requirements is key to the role.


Multi-tasking - We are a busy team who deal with approximately 3,000 requests for information each year, so being able to prioritise and work on a number of tasks simultaneously is a must.
